Gas meter protective sleeve device

By designing a protective sleeve device for gas meters, and utilizing solenoid valves and gas concentration sensors to automatically shut off the gas valves, the problem of exposed gas meters being easily damaged and unable to be shut off in time when leaks occur is solved, thus achieving external protection and stable installation of gas meters.

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of gas meters, and particularly discloses a gas meter protective sleeve device which comprises a gas meter outer cover, an electromagnetic valve is fixedly arranged on the top of the gas meter outer cover, the top inlet end of the electromagnetic valve is communicated with a gas pipe, and the bottom outlet end of the electromagnetic valve is communicated with the inlet end of a gas meter. A gas concentration sensor is fixedly arranged on the vertical face of one side of the gas meter outer cover, and a controller is fixedly arranged outside the electromagnetic valve. According to the technical scheme, the outer cover of the gas meter is installed outside the gas meter for external collision protection, the electromagnetic valve is connected between the gas pipe and the inlet end of the gas meter in series, the gas concentration sensor is used for detecting the gas concentration, the electromagnetic valve is closed when gas leaks, gas conveying is cut off, and gas leakage is avoided. And the effect of automatically closing gas conveying in time when gas leaks is achieved.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of gas meter technology, specifically a gas meter protective sleeve device. Background Technology

[0002] Gas meters, as a means of metering and settlement between gas suppliers and users, accurately record the amount of gas used by users. This provides a reliable data foundation for billing between users and gas companies, ensuring that users pay according to the actual amount of gas used. To eliminate the risk of gas fires, gas meters need to be installed in conspicuous locations so that users can promptly shut off the gas in case of a leak. Currently, gas meters are all exposed externally, and are generally installed in kitchen areas. The temperature of kitchen fumes and people handling items can damage the gas meters. Therefore, we propose a gas meter protective sleeve device. Utility Model Content

[0003]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a gas meter protective sleeve device, which solves the problems mentioned in the background art.

[0004]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a gas meter protective cover device, including a gas meter cover, a solenoid valve fixedly installed on the top of the gas meter cover, the top inlet end of the solenoid valve being connected to a gas pipe, the bottom outlet end of the solenoid valve being connected to the inlet end of the gas meter, a gas concentration sensor fixedly installed on one vertical side of the gas meter cover, and a controller fixedly installed outside the solenoid valve.

[0005] Furthermore, an operation window is provided on the vertical front surface of the gas meter cover, and a baffle is installed on the vertical front surface of the gas meter cover via a pivot pin, the baffle matching the shape of the operation window.

[0006] Furthermore, the operation window is semi-circular in shape.

[0007] Furthermore, both the gas meter cover and the baffle are made of transparent PC material.

[0008] Furthermore, four suction cup bases are fixedly installed on the outside of the gas meter cover, and the four suction cup bases are rectangularly distributed around the outside of the gas meter cover.

[0009] Furthermore, the top of the gas meter casing has a through slot to accommodate the gas meter outlet end protruding.

[0010]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:

[0011] 1. The gas meter cover of this application is installed outside the gas meter for external impact protection. A solenoid valve is connected in series between the gas pipe and the gas meter inlet. A gas concentration sensor detects the gas concentration. In the event of a gas leak, the solenoid valve is closed to cut off the gas supply, thus achieving the effect of automatically shutting off the gas supply in a timely manner when a gas leak occurs.

[0012] 2. The gas meter cover of this application is provided with four suction cup bases around its perimeter, which are used to attach the gas meter cover to the surface of the kitchen tile to improve installation stability. The baffle can rotate around the pivot pin to facilitate operation of the buttons on the surface of the gas meter. When not in use, the baffle blocks the operation window due to its own weight, which is used to block the operation window. Attached Figure Description

[0016] In the diagram: 1. Gas meter cover; 2. Operation window; 3. Suction cup base; 4. Solenoid valve; 5. Controller; 6. Through groove; 7. Gas concentration sensor; 8. Baffle; 9. Shaft pin. Detailed Implementation

[0017] The technical solutions of the present utility model will be clearly and completely described below with reference to the accompanying drawings of the embodiments of the present utility model. Obviously, the described embodiments are only some embodiments of the present utility model, and not all embodiments.

[0018] Example 1, as Figure 1-2 As shown, this utility model provides a technical solution: a gas meter protective cover device, including a gas meter cover 1, a solenoid valve 4 fixedly installed on the top of the gas meter cover 1, the top inlet end of the solenoid valve 4 being connected to the gas pipe, the bottom outlet end of the solenoid valve 4 being connected to the gas meter inlet end, a gas concentration sensor 7 fixedly installed on one vertical side of the gas meter cover 1, and a controller 5 fixedly installed outside the solenoid valve 4.

[0019] In one specific embodiment of this utility model, the top inlet end of the solenoid valve 4 is connected to the gas pipe, the bottom outlet end of the solenoid valve 4 is connected to the inlet end of the gas meter, the outlet end of the gas meter is engaged with the through groove 6, and the outlet end of the gas meter is connected to the gas equipment through the gas pipe. Gas flows from the gas pipe through the solenoid valve 4 and the gas meter, and finally reaches the gas equipment. The gas concentration sensor 7 is used to detect the gas concentration. When a gas leak occurs, the gas concentration increases, and the gas concentration sensor 7 detects that the concentration value is too high. After the controller 5 processes the detection data of the gas concentration sensor 7, it automatically controls the solenoid valve 4 to switch from the conducting state to the closed state after processing by the set program, so as to cut off the gas supply in time and avoid continuous gas leakage. Four suction cup bases 3 are set around the gas meter cover 1 to attach the gas meter cover 1 to the surface of the kitchen tile. The baffle 8 can rotate around the shaft pin 9. Rotating the baffle 8 exposes the operation window 2, which is convenient for operating the buttons on the surface of the gas meter. When not in use, the baffle 8 blocks the operation window 2 due to its own weight, which is used to block the operation window 2.

[0020] In the preferred technical solution, an operation window 2 is provided on the front vertical surface of the gas meter cover 1. A baffle 8 is hinged to the front vertical surface of the gas meter cover 1 via a pivot pin 9. The baffle 8 matches the shape of the operation window 2. The operation window 2 is semi-circular in shape. When not in use, the baffle 8 blocks the operation window 2 due to its own weight, thus sealing the operation window 2.

[0021] In the preferred technical solution, both the gas meter cover 1 and the baffle 8 are made of transparent PC material, which makes it easy to observe the gas meter readings and operating status.

[0022] In the preferred technical solution, four suction cup bases 3 are fixedly installed on the outside of the gas meter cover 1. The four suction cup bases 3 are rectangularly distributed around the outside of the gas meter cover 1. The four suction cup bases 3 are used to attach the gas meter cover 1 to the surface of the kitchen tile, thereby improving the stability of the gas meter cover 1 installation.

[0023] In the preferred technical solution, the top of the gas meter cover 1 is provided with a through groove 6 for accommodating the gas meter outlet end. The gas meter cover 1 is offset from the gas meter outlet end, so that the gas meter cover 1 can be installed in close contact with the wall.

[0024] Working principle: The solenoid valve 4 is connected in series between the gas pipe and the gas meter inlet. The gas concentration sensor 7 detects the gas concentration. When there is a gas leak, the controller 5 closes the solenoid valve 4 to cut off the gas supply. The baffle 8 is rotated to expose the operation window 2. The baffle 8 can rotate around the shaft pin 9 to facilitate the operation of the buttons on the surface of the gas meter. When not in use, the baffle 8 is blocked in the operation window 2 by its own weight to seal the operation window 2.
